What fence material holds up best against termites and rust in Fort Denaud?
Use non-organic materials. The River District has a Very Heavy termite risk, ruling out wood posts in ground contact. Aluminum or vinyl are superior for panels. For any steel components like post brackets, specify G90 galvanized coating due to the area's Moderate soil corrosivity index. Stainless steel fasteners prevent rust streaks on light-colored materials.
Does a smart gate meet Florida's pool fence code?
Yes, if properly integrated. The Florida Residential Swimming Pool Safety Act (515.27) requires self-closing, self-latching gates. A smart gate with an IoT-enabled latch that automatically engages upon closure meets this standard. This integration provides access logs, which are valuable for liability documentation. The moderate smart-gate trend in 2026 focuses on these code-compliant systems.
How deep should my fence posts be in Fort Denaud if there's no frost?
Florida's IRC R403.1.4 requires footings to be stable against wind scour and heaving from expansive soils. In the River District's moderate soil, we set posts 24 to 30 inches deep for a 150 MPH V-ult wind rating. This depth anchors the structure against uplift from SR 80 wind exposure and prevents lean from soil saturation after heavy rain.
What are the height rules for a fence on my corner lot near SR 80?
Fort Denaud zoning enforces a 4-foot height limit in front yards and 6 feet in rear yards. For corner lots, a visibility 'sight triangle' is required at the intersection. No structure over 3 feet tall is permitted within 10 feet of the property corner to maintain driver sightlines for traffic from SR 80. The setback is 0 feet, allowing installation directly on the property line.

Am I legally required to tell my neighbor before building a fence on the property line?
Yes. Florida Statute 588.011, the 'Good Neighbor Fence Law,' requires written notice to adjoining landowners before replacing or building a partition fence on a shared boundary. In Fort Denaud, this 2026 legal step is mandatory to establish shared cost liability and prevent future disputes over maintenance responsibility.
Is a standard 8-foot panel strong enough for Fort Denaud's wind?
No. The 150 MPH V-ult wind speed rating under ASCE 7-22 standards dictates engineering. For a 6-foot tall fence, this typically requires reducing post spacing to 6 feet on-center, using concrete footings, and installing wind-rated metal brackets. This design withstands peak storm season gusts channeled from the Caloosahatchee River Bridge area.
What is required before you dig the first post hole?
State law requires a Sunshine 811 utility locate request at least two full business days before digging. In the River District, hitting a buried irrigation or telecom line is a major liability. We manage the 811 ticket and concurrently file the permit application with the Hendry County Building Department to align the inspection schedule with the utility markouts.
